    BHESCo stands for Brighton and Hove Energy Services Co-operative. It is a not-for-profit social enterprise that works with homes and businesses in Sussex to make energy more financially and environmentally sustainable. As a not-for-profit business, any profits it does make are re-invested into new clean energy projects or used to help alleviate the crisis of fuel poverty in our community. BHESCo is a co-operative business - what does that mean? Being a co-operative means that BHESCo is jointly owned by its members, who share in the benefits and profits of the business. Its members are made up of its shareholders and its customers, who are invited to participate in the election of board members, the distribution of interest, and other business decisions during its Annual General Meeting. As a co-operative its members have an equal say in how the business is run, meaning members have one vote each at meetings, regardless of how many shares they own.

CONTACT US We will thoroughly inspect the site and discuss all your requirements with you before issuing a quote. During the survey, we will assess the available area for fitting panels, where the inverter is to be located, and estimate cable runs between all components, as well as the distribution board for the whole system. We take into account issues such as shading from nearby trees and structures, as this can significantly affect the power supply generated by the panels. The survey will of course include an estimate of the total power you should expect to get from the system.

How do I choose the right solar panel system size for my needs?

Choosing the right solar panel system size depends on your energy consumption, budget, and available roof space. A qualified solar installer will:
  • Analyze your energy bills
  • Assess your roof's suitability
  • Calculate your potential solar energy generation
  • Recommend a system size that meets your needs and goals.
They will also consider factors like future energy needs (e.g., if you plan to purchase an electric vehicle) and the potential for battery storage.

Do I need to replace my roof before installing solar panels?

It's not always necessary to replace your roof before installing solar panels. If your roof is in good condition and has several years of life left, solar panels can be installed on it. However, if your roof is nearing the end of its lifespan or shows signs of damage, it's advisable to replace it before the solar installation to avoid the cost and hassle of removing and reinstalling panels later. A solar installer can help assess your roof's condition and advise on whether a roof replacement is necessary.

What are the different types of solar panels?

The most common types of solar panels are:
  • Monocrystalline: Made from a single silicon crystal, known for high efficiency (typically 18-22%) and sleek black appearance.
  • Polycrystalline: Made from multiple silicon crystals, slightly less efficient (15-17%) but often more affordable than monocrystalline.
  • Thin-film: Made from thin layers of photovoltaic material, lower efficiency (8-12%) but can be flexible and lightweight.
The best type of panel for your project will depend on your budget, roof space, and desired energy output.

Are there any financial incentives for going solar?

Yes, many governments and utilities offer financial incentives to encourage solar adoption, such as:
  • Tax Credits: Reduce your income tax liability based on the cost of your solar system.
  • Rebates: Direct cash payments or discounts on the purchase of a solar energy system.
  • Net Metering: Allows you to sell excess solar electricity back to the grid for credits.
  • Renewable Energy Certificates (RECs): Tradeable credits representing the environmental attributes of your solar energy generation.
The availability and specifics of incentives vary by location, so check with your local government and utility for details.
